Netflix is set to release a groundbreaking documentary on the legendary band Earth, Wind & Fire, directed by Ahmir “Questlove” Thompson. This highly anticipated film, scheduled for a 2025 premiere, promises to offer an in-depth exploration of the band’s profound impact on music and culture.(Stairway to 11, WBLS)

Earth, Wind & Fire, formed in 1969 by the late Maurice White, has sold over 90 million records worldwide, earning six Grammy Awards and 11 consecutive gold or platinum albums. Their fusion of R&B, funk, jazz, and soul, combined with Afrocentric themes and spiritual messages, has left an indelible mark on the music industry. Hits like “September,” “Shining Star,” and “Let’s Groove” continue to resonate with audiences across generations.(Black Enterprise, Stairway to 11)

Questlove, known for his Oscar-winning documentary “Summer of Soul,” brings his deep appreciation for music history to this project. He expressed his personal connection to the band, stating, “Having been baptized in the Afrocentric joy river of this powerhouse unit, I’ve learned about them, I’ve learned about us & more importantly, I’ve learned and rediscovered myself in the process.” He aims to present a narrative that delves into the band’s journey of “Soul, Self & Struggle,” highlighting their resilience and cultural significance.(NME, Stairway to 11, WBLS)

The documentary will feature unprecedented access to Earth, Wind & Fire’s archives, including visual, audio, and written materials. With the full support of Maurice White’s estate and current band members Philip Bailey, Verdine White, and Ralph Johnson, the film is poised to be a definitive account of the band’s legacy. In a joint statement, the members expressed their enthusiasm: “We look forward to this in-depth journey of our band, and are so excited to have Questlove directing the documentary.”(Stairway to 11, Relix Media)

Produced in collaboration with Sony Music Vision, RadicalMedia, Broken Halo Entertainment, and Kinfolk Management + Media, the documentary is financed by Fifth Season. Mary Lisio, EVP of Non-Scripted Development & Production at Fifth Season, remarked, “This is an incredibly exciting opportunity to give audiences unfettered access to one of the most successful and culturally meaningful music groups in history.”(Black Enterprise, Relix Media)
